Industry Interaction and Expert Talk by AIML Dept

With the aim  to expose AI&ML students to real-world industry practices, the Department of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ning (AIML) Association organized an Industry Interaction Session for the students of  S4 AI&ML on 17 December 2025. The primary objective of the session was to guide and prepare students for careers in the industry, equipping them with the knowledge and skills necessary to successfully crack interviews and secure suitable job opportunities.

The session began with an introductory address by Ms. Riya P. D. (Association In-charge, Asst Prof, AIML Dept) who highlighted the importance of industry interactions in shaping students’ professional careers and bridging the gap between academic learning and industry expectations.

The session was conducted by Mr. Sinoj Chittilappilly George (Senior Software Engineer at Kaleris, German) a highly experienced .NET & REACT Full-Stack developer with expertise spanning multiple domains and entrepreneurship. He is proficient in team management, technical design, and system implementation, with strong communication and leadership abilities.

During the session, Mr. Sinoj shared his valuable industry experiences and provided practical guidance on interview preparation, strategies to get hired by top companies, selecting the right internships, and the essential technical and professional skills required to succeed in the software industry. The session was highly engaging, with students actively participating in the Q&A segment, gaining clarity on current industry expectations, career pathways, and the skill sets needed to excel in the competitive job market.

The session concluded with a vote of thanks by Dr. Jeeva K A (HoD, AIML Dept) who expressed gratitude to the guest speaker for sharing his expertise. As a token of appreciation, Dr. Jeeva presented a gift to Mr. Sinoj Chittilappilly George on behalf of the AI&ML Association and the Department.

The session was highly successful, and students expressed their sincere appreciation to the department and the guest speaker for organizing such an informative and interactive event.
